What It Is:
This is a worksheet focusing on quadratic applications in geometry. It presents word problems where students must use quadratic equations to solve for dimensions of rectangles and squares. Problems include finding length and width given area, working with shaded regions, factoring quadratic expressions to find dimensions, and optimizing area with a fixed perimeter.

How to Use It:
Students should read each problem carefully, draw diagrams if needed, and set up quadratic equations based on the given information. They then solve for the unknown variables (length, width, side length) using factoring, the quadratic formula, or other appropriate methods. Finally, they should check their answers to ensure they make sense in the context of the problem.
